What Is a Bearing Supplier?

A Bearing Supplier is a business that manufactures or distributes bearings for industrial and commercial clients. Bearings are critical mechanical components that reduce friction between moving parts, so a qualified bearing supplier must meet strict quality standards to ensure equipment safety and longevity. In practice, we see that 60% of unplanned industrial equipment downtime in 2026 can be traced back to low-quality bearings from unvetted suppliers, per recent Bearing Industry Association research.

Q: What’s the difference between a bearing manufacturer and a bearing supplier?

A: Some bearing suppliers are direct manufacturers, while others act as third-party distributors for multiple brands. Direct manufacturers like HUHAI Bearing typically offer lower prices and more flexible customization options, while distributors often provide faster access to rare niche bearing sizes. From our experience, working with a direct supplier is the most cost-effective choice for bulk or custom orders.

Step-by-Step Criteria to Vet a Reliable Bearing Supplier

Before signing a contract with any Bearing Supplier, you need to verify core credentials to avoid costly quality issues. The industry consensus is that unqualified suppliers often cut corners on raw material quality and heat treatment, leading to 2-3x shorter bearing service life. Based on decades of industry experience, here is our recommended vetting process:

  1. Verify valid third-party quality certifications, such as ISO 9001, IATF 16949 for automotive, or AS9100 for aerospace applications.
  2. Request and test physical samples to check dimensional accuracy, material hardness, and load capacity before placing a bulk order.
  3. Confirm the supplier’s production capacity and lead times to ensure they can match your order volume and delivery deadlines.
  4. Review past client case studies and reviews from businesses in your specific industry to confirm consistent performance.

Common Mistakes to Avoid When Selecting a Bearing Supplier

The most common mistake buyers make is prioritizing the lowest upfront price over long-term quality. In practice, we see that buyers who save $0.5 per unit on cheap bearings end up paying 10x more in downtime and replacement costs over just 2 years of use. Other common mistakes include failing to test samples before placing bulk orders, ignoring after-sales support policies, and not confirming the supplier can scale up production as your business grows.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: How much does a bearing from a reliable supplier cost?

A: Costs vary based on bearing size, type, material, and order volume. Standard small bearings from direct suppliers like HUHAI typically cost $1-$5 per unit, with bulk discounts available for orders over 1,000 units. Larger industrial bearings can cost $100-$1,000 per unit depending on specifications.

Q: What is the typical lead time for a bearing order?

A: For standard, in-stock bearing sizes, most reliable direct suppliers deliver within 7-15 business days. Custom bearing orders usually take 20-30 business days, depending on the complexity of your design requirements.

Q: Can I get a sample before placing a bulk order?

Q: What types of bearings do most suppliers offer?

A: Full-service bearing suppliers offer all common types including deep groove ball bearings, tapered roller bearings, cylindrical roller bearings, spherical roller bearings, and thrust bearings. Most leading suppliers also offer custom options for specialized industrial applications.
